Maidir Liom
Lauvlyer is a small townland located in County Mayo in the west of Ireland, situated within the broader landscape of Connacht. Like many Irish townlands, it represents one of the smallest administrative divisions in the Irish territorial system, with its own distinct boundaries and local identity. The area is characterized by the undulating terrain typical of County Mayo, with rolling hills, pastoral fields, and the natural drainage patterns that define the western Irish countryside. The landscape reflects the region's maritime climate and geological history, featuring the green fields and stone walls common to rural Mayo.
